If it takes 5 years for an animal population to double, how many years will it take until the population
muminat

9514 1404 393

Answer:

  7.92 years

Step-by-step explanation:

We want to find t such that ...

  3 = 2^(t/5)

where 2^(t/5) is the annual multiplier when doubling time is 5 years.

Taking logs, we have ...

  log(3) = (t/5)log(2)

  t = 5·log(3)/log(2) ≈ 7.92 . . . years

It will take about 7.92 years for the population to triple.
